
The Black Stars of Ghana may be without striker Iñaki Williams for the final round of the 2026 FIFA World Cup qualifiers, following an injury scare over the weekend.
The 28-year-old forward was included in Otto Addo’s 24-man squad for the decisive fixtures against Central African Republic and Comoros later this month.
However, his participation is now in doubt after picking up an injury in Athletic Club’s 2-1 La Liga victory over RCD Mallorca on Saturday at San Mamés.
Williams, who had just ended his goal drought in the game, was forced off in the 53rd minute, with his younger brother Nico Williams coming on as his replacement.
Athletic Club have yet to disclose the nature or severity of the injury.
The Black Stars are scheduled to begin their training camp in Casablanca on Sunday, October 5, ahead of the clash with Central African Republic on Wednesday, October 8, at the Stade d’Honneur de Meknès.
They will then return home to face Comoros on Sunday, October 12, at the Accra Sports Stadium.
Ghana require at least four points from the two matches to seal qualification for their fifth World Cup appearance.
